Decade path · College Scorecard

Selectivity moved on only one side of this board

ADM-ASYM · 2013–2023

Over 2013–2023, one school's acceptance-rate series clears the r² ≥ 0.40 floor while the other does not. Read the directional claim as one-sided, then check the companion metric below.

  • Johns Hopkins University: acceptance rate tightened -58.3% across 2013–2023 (r² 0.94).
  • The College of New Jersey: acceptance rate eased +44.1% across 2013–2023 (r² 0.76).
  • The College of New Jersey: enrollment grew +6.0% over 2013–2023; fitted +46 students/yr fitted, r² 0.62.
  • Johns Hopkins University: enrollment shrank -5.3% over 2013–2023; fitted -29 students/yr fitted, r² 0.44.

College Scorecard institution series; dollars are nominal. Direction claims require r² ≥ 0.40 on the fitted annual slope, otherwise the page reports the observed range. Descriptive history, not a recommendation.

Largest gaps: The College of New Jersey vs Johns Hopkins University

  1. ACCEPTANCE-RATE Johns Hopkins University leads on acceptance rate (6.4% vs 62.3% at The College of New Jersey)
  2. IN-STATE-TUITION The College of New Jersey leads on in-state tuition ($19,632 vs $65,230 at Johns Hopkins University)
  3. OUT-OF-STATE-TUITI The College of New Jersey leads on out-of-state tuition ($25,752 vs $65,230 at Johns Hopkins University)
